    I am 2 months Post-Op and my biggest problem with my sleeve is eating out! It is not ordering food, because I am on regular food. It is telling the wait staff I do not want a drink with my food. I am treated like a space alien, when I say "I do not want anything to drink." The wait staff will circle back around and check to make sure I do not want anything to drink and look at me like I am crazy. I love it! On Thursday, The Olive Garden waiter felt I needed a water, so he brought me one, even though I did not ask for a drink. I think I am going to start telling them I have a water/soda allergy! Lets see how they react. Honestly, other than throwing up a few times from accidentally overfilling my pouch, that is the only problem I have. Pre-ops, feel comfortable knowing life goes back to normal pretty much after six weeks, but your stomach limits you and I love it. I just finished eating 10 wheat thins with cheese and I feel satisfied. Before, I would eat the box. So feel confident that the sleeve works out. Read my blog, if you want more tips! Happy Journey!

    Our new stomachs can be compared to a baby's stomach. The baby is on liquids, then thicker liquids if you choose to put a dab of baby Cereal in the milk to thicken it up, then on to puréed foods and so on. We don't give babies a chicken leg at 1 month old do we? Lol I certainly hope not.
    We should not be so quick to want to introduce all of the foods we once ate and loved before its time. Protect our stomachs like we would protect our babies' stomachs.
